Management highlights

• BioCardia is advancing targeted cellular precision medicines for cardiovascular disease, with clinical stage cell-based therapies like CardiAMP for heart failure. • CardiAMP Heart Failure I trial is a randomized placebo procedure-controlled study with ~92% of patients having two-year follow-up, final results expected in Q1 2025. • CardiAMP Heart Failure II trial is a 250-patient pivotal study, with FDA protocol amendment increasing eligible patients, and enrollment expected to be enhanced. • Other programs: Last rolling cohort patient in CardiAMP cell therapy and chronic myocardial ischemia trial enrolled, CardiALLO allogeneic mesenchymal stem cell therapy enrollment ongoing. • Helix biotherapeutic delivery partnering: No updates, focused on long-term partnerships. • Morph DNA product family FDA approved, with commercial plans and physician usage focus. • Q3 2024 financials: Total expenses decreased 41% q-o-q to $1.8 million, R&D expenses down to $931,000, SG&A expenses down to $825,000, net loss decreased to $1.7 million.

Guidance

• Cash burn expected to increase moderately over the coming year. • Anticipation of final data from CardiAMP Heart Failure I trial in Q1 2025. • Upcoming consultation with Japan PMDA for CardiAMP cell therapy. • Protocol amendment in CardiAMP Heart Failure II trial expected to enhance enrollment.

Q&A highlights

Q: What are the potential options for monetizing the Morph DNA program?

A: Options include distribution, selling the business unit outright; demonstrating physician utility, exploring divestment pathways while retaining exclusive rights to the platform technology for biotherapeutic intervention.

Q: Regarding Japan efforts for CardiAMP, what's the process and timing?

A: Scheduled consultation with Japan PMDA this month, aiming for clinical consultation and potential approval pathway in heart failure in Japan, with positive signals from PMDA so far.

Q: What percentage of patients would fit the protocol amendment profile in CardiAMP II trial and how were similar patients treated in CardiAMP I trial?

A: About 85% of patients are expected to pass the threshold, with previously excluded patients within 35% of the threshold now able to receive additional dosages; in CardiAMP I trial, patients were excluded if not meeting pre-specified criteria, now amendment allows more patients to be eligible with additional dosages.
